Guns N’ Roses India Tour 2025 Confirmed: Mumbai to Host Historic Comeback

Legendary rock band Guns N Roses will perform in Mumbai on May 17, 2025, marking their return to India after a 12-year hiatus. The iconic group, led by vocalist Axl Rose and featuring hits like Sweet Child O’ Mine and Welcome to the Jungle, will headline a high-energy show at Mahalaxmi Racecourse. Organized by BookMyShow Live, the event follows their last India performance in 2012, reigniting excitement among rock enthusiasts nationwide.

Event Details and Ticket Sales

Pre-sale tickets for the Guns N’ Roses India Tour 2025 begin on March 17 at 12 PM IST, with general sales starting March 19 at 4 PM IST. Fans can secure passes via BookMyShow Live, the official promoter.

Anil Makhija, COO of BookMyShow Live, highlighted the band’s cultural impact: “Guns N’ Roses defined a generation of rock. Bringing them back to India is a career milestone.” The announcement aligns with India’s growing live music scene, recently showcased by Green Day’s debut at Lollapalooza India 2025.

Why This Concert Matters

Guns N’ Roses’ discography spans decades, blending hard rock anthems with ballads like November Rain. Their Mumbai gig joins a wave of international acts touring India, reflecting the country’s emergence as a key market for live entertainment.
